    Understanding BMW 1 Series Finance Options

    Alright, so you're keen on the BMW 1 Series, and that's fantastic. But before you jump headfirst into the buying process, let's talk about the different ways you can actually finance it. Understanding these options is the first step towards getting the best deal possible. There are several popular finance options available, each with its own pros and cons, so let's break them down to find which one aligns with your financial goals and lifestyle. First, we'll look at the classic Hire Purchase (HP), the most straightforward route to owning your BMW 1 Series. It involves paying a deposit upfront, followed by monthly installments over a set period. Once you've made all the payments, the car is officially yours. Next, we have Personal Contract Purchase (PCP), a flexible option gaining popularity. With PCP, you also pay a deposit and monthly payments, but at the end of the term, you have three choices: make a final balloon payment to own the car, return the car to the finance company, or use any equity in the car to put towards a new vehicle. This is great if you like to upgrade your car frequently. The monthly payments are often lower than HP because you're not paying off the full value of the car. There's also the option of a Personal Loan, where you borrow the money from a bank or credit union to buy the car outright. You own the car from day one, giving you the freedom to sell it whenever you like, but you're responsible for the full amount, plus interest, from the get-go.

    Finally, for those who love flexibility, there's Leasing, also known as Personal Contract Hire (PCH). You effectively rent the car for a set period, typically 2-4 years. You make monthly payments, but you never own the car. At the end of the lease, you simply return it, and you're free to choose a new model. Leasing is often attractive because it involves lower monthly payments than other options, and you don't have to worry about depreciation or selling the car.     Comparing Different BMW 1 Series Finance Packages

    Alright, so you've done your research, and now it's time to start comparing those BMW 1 Series finance packages. Comparing different finance packages is a critical step in finding the perfect deal. Each package has its own terms, conditions, and benefits, so it's essential to compare them carefully to make an informed decision. First off, what are the interest rates like? This is a huge factor. Pay close attention to the Annual Percentage Rate (APR). A lower APR means less interest, which saves you money over the course of the loan. Ensure you compare the APRs across different finance packages. Also, compare the monthly payments. Different finance packages will have different monthly payment options. Make sure the monthly payments fit within your budget and do not put a strain on your finances. Also, think about the loan term. The loan term (the length of time you have to repay the finance) can vary. A shorter term means higher monthly payments but less interest overall. A longer term means lower monthly payments but more interest. Choose a term that suits your financial situation. Don't forget about the total cost. Calculate the total cost of the finance, including all interest and any fees. It's often more important than just looking at the monthly payments. Compare the total cost of each package to see which one is the most cost-effective. Another thing to consider is the deposit requirements. Some finance packages require a deposit, while others don't. Think about how much you can afford to put down as a deposit, as a larger deposit often leads to lower monthly payments. If you want to own the car, look into the ownership options. If you want to own the BMW 1 Series at the end of the finance term, check the options. Hire purchase (HP) is a great option for this. If you prefer to change cars frequently, a Personal Contract Purchase (PCP) might be better, where you have options at the end of the term. Also, look out for fees. Finance packages can come with fees, such as arrangement fees, early repayment fees, or late payment fees. Make sure you're aware of any fees and factor them into your comparison. And finally, what extras are available? Some finance packages include extras such as GAP insurance or breakdown cover. Assess whether these extras are useful to you and whether they add value to the package.     Tips for a Smooth Finance Application

    Alright, so you've found a great BMW 1 Series finance deal and are ready to apply. But before you dive in, here are some tips to make the application process as smooth and successful as possible. A little preparation can go a long way in securing that approval. The first thing to consider is to check your credit score. Your credit score is a crucial factor in the finance application process. Before you apply, obtain a copy of your credit report from credit reference agencies. This will allow you to see your credit score and identify any potential issues that could affect your application. If there are any errors or negative marks on your credit report, take steps to rectify them before applying. Next, gather all necessary documentation. Lenders will require specific documents to verify your identity, income, and financial stability. Common documents include proof of address (such as a utility bill), proof of income (such as payslips or tax returns), and bank statements. Make sure you have all the required documents ready before you apply to avoid delays. Also, always be honest and accurate on your application. Providing false or misleading information on your finance application can lead to rejection. Fill out the application form completely and accurately, providing honest details about your income, employment history, and financial situation. Also, keep your debt-to-income ratio in mind. Lenders assess your debt-to-income ratio (DTI) to determine your ability to repay the loan. DTI is the percentage of your gross monthly income that goes towards debt payments. Ideally, aim for a low DTI. Paying down existing debts before applying for finance can improve your chances of approval. Also, consider the impact on your credit score. Applying for multiple finance applications within a short period can negatively impact your credit score. Each application generates a hard inquiry on your credit report, which can slightly lower your score. Only apply for finance when you are serious about purchasing a car and have researched your options. Also, check the terms and conditions carefully. Before signing any finance agreement, carefully review the terms and conditions. Pay close attention to the interest rate, repayment terms, and any fees or penalties associated with the loan. Make sure you understand all the terms before committing. Also, read the fine print. This is extremely important, to avoid any surprises down the line. Finally, don't be afraid to ask questions. If you're unsure about any aspect of the finance application or the terms of the agreement, don't hesitate to ask questions. Contact the lender or dealership for clarification.     Frequently Asked Questions About BMW 1 Series Finance Deals

    Alright, you've gone through the main points, but what about some of the more common questions people have about BMW 1 Series finance deals? Let's take a look. First, do I need a deposit for BMW 1 Series finance? The answer depends on the finance option and the lender. Some finance options, such as Hire Purchase (HP) and Personal Contract Purchase (PCP), typically require a deposit. However, some lenders may offer deals with no deposit required. Putting down a larger deposit can reduce your monthly payments and potentially secure a better interest rate. Next, can I get finance with bad credit? Getting finance with bad credit can be more challenging, but it's not impossible. Lenders may offer finance to individuals with bad credit, but the interest rates may be higher. Consider improving your credit score before applying for finance. Also, are there any early repayment penalties? Some finance agreements include early repayment penalties. Review the terms and conditions of your finance agreement to see if there are any penalties for repaying the loan early. If you plan to pay off the finance early, check with the lender to understand any associated costs. Moreover, what happens at the end of a PCP agreement? At the end of a Personal Contract Purchase (PCP) agreement, you have several options: you can make a final balloon payment to own the car, return the car to the finance company, or use any equity in the car to put towards a new vehicle. Also, can I trade in my existing car? Yes, you can usually trade in your existing car to put towards the purchase of a BMW 1 Series. The trade-in value of your car can be used as a deposit or to reduce the amount you need to finance. Also, how long does the finance application take? The time it takes to process a finance application can vary. It usually takes a few days to a couple of weeks to get approved. Make sure you have all the necessary documentation ready to expedite the process. Do finance deals include insurance? No, finance deals typically do not include insurance. You will need to arrange your own car insurance coverage. Compare insurance quotes from different providers to find the best deal. And finally, what if I change my mind after signing the finance agreement? Most finance agreements include a cooling-off period, during which you can cancel the agreement without penalty. Read the terms and conditions of your agreement to understand the cooling-off period and cancellation process.
